Abstract

1382540 Electrolytic treatment of cyanidecontaining water STANLEY DENKI K K 29 June 1973 [29 June 1972] 30970/73 Heading C7B Waste water containing at least one cyanide e.g. from a cyanogen-zinc complex salt is treated by adding to the waste water having a pH greater than 10 a material which produces OCl<SP>-</SP> ion in solution, such as bleaching powder or NaOCl, electrolyzing it to produce cyanic acid so lowering the pH to less than 9 by the H<SP>+</SP> ions simultaneously produced, whereby a secondary reaction between the CNO<SP>-</SP> and OCl<SP>-</SP> ions occurs to produce N 2 and CO 2 . If the pH of the waste water is less than 10, NaOH, may be added to raise it to more than 10. The cell may comprise graphite electrodes: a central anode with two outer cathodes.
